Those interested in the life and legacy of Jimmy Stewart can now enter a video contest showcasing their knowledge of the famed actor and Indiana native.
The Jimmy Stewart Museum is hosting its inaugural video essay showcase and are calling for enthusiasts to submit works on any theme or concept that relates to Stewart’s life and/or work in Hollywood. Entries must be under 10 minutes, contain narration, photos, movie clips, etc.; and be educational in nature.
Museum President and Executive Director Janie McKirgan said this contest is a good way to keep Stewart’s life and legacy alive.
McKirgan adds winning submissions could be featured on social media and/or at the museum itself.
Winners will be invited to present their work at a virtual symposium on Stewart’s birthday: May 20th. You can view submission guidelines by clicking below.
